Missouri Red Cross Seeking Volunteers
COLUMBIA, Mo. (AP) - The Heart of Missouri chapter of the American Red Cross needs more volunteers.
The Columbia Daily Tribune reports that the Red Cross chapter serves 21 central Missouri counties and has about 250 trained volunteers.
The organization says that's enough to deal with events that affect a few families, but it's not enough to deal with a larger disaster like the 2011 tornado that struck Joplin.
Phillip Iman, a disaster specialist with the organization, says the group doesn't have a target number for how many volunteers it should have, but it's always looking to bolster its ranks to make sure the volunteers it does have aren't overburdened.
